9 / 15 page PRECAUTIONS FOR PROPER USE DP2 800 Measurement 3 Pressure value setting 2 Initial setting 1 Zero-point adjustment 3 Pressure value setting For the case when output mode is set to either hysteresis mode ( ), window comparator mode ( ) or dual output mode ( ). • ‘Set Value 1 (P-1)’ and Set Value 2 (P-2)’ of the com- parative outputs are set. • Press key in the sensing mode to set to Set Value 1 (P-1) set mode. • Enter Set Value 1 (P-1) using key and key. • Then, press key to set to Set Value 2 (P-2) set mode. • Enter Set Value 2 (P-2) using key and key. • Then, press key to set to sensing mode. MODE MODE MODE 2 Initial setting • Pressure ‘Unit’, ‘Display’ and ‘Output mode’ of the comparative outputs are set. • In the sensing mode, press key while press- ing key. • Initial setting is displayed. • If sensor is being used for the first time, is displayed. • The settable digit blinks. • The settable digit changes when key is pressed and the setting is changed when key is pressed. MODE • If key-protect has been set, make sure to release key-protect before operating the keys. (Please refer to ‘Key-protect function’ on p.801 for the procedure.) • Set Value 1 (P-1) and Set Value 2 (P-2) can be made common for all the output modes. • The setting of Set Value 2 (P-2) with respect to Set Value 1 (P-1) can only be towards the high pressure side in case of the positive pressure type sensor and only towards the high vacuum side in case of the vacuum pressure type sensor. • Set Value 3 (P-3) is automatically set to the mid-value of Set Value 1 (P-1) and Set Value 2 (P-2). (When setting the pressure value for the automatic sensitivity mode) • The conditions which are set are stored in an EEPROM. Kindly note that the EEPROM has a life span and its guaranteed life is 100,000 write operation cycles. All models Setting procedure Adjust zero-point Set ‘Display’, ‘Output mode’, and ‘Unit’ Enter Set Value 1 (P-1), Set Value 2 (P-2), Set Value 3 (P-3) Commence measurement on completion of setting DP2-20 –101.3kPa OUT2 OUT1 MODE 0-ADJ For the case when output mode is set to automatic sensitivity setting mode ( ). • ‘Set Value 1 (P-1)’, ‘Set Value 2 (P-2)’ and ‘Set Value 3 (P-3)’ of the comparative outputs are set. • Press key in the sensing mode to set to Set Value 1 (P-1) set mode. • Within the required permissible pressure range, having created a pressure state which is nearest to the atmospheric pressure, press key to enter Set Value 1 (P-1). • Then, press key to set to Set Value 2 (P-2) set mode. • Within the required permissible pressure range, having created a pressure state which is nearest to the high pressure end (for a positive pressure type sensor) or the high vacuum end (for a vacuum pressure type sensor), press key to enter Set Value 2 (P-2). • Then, press key to set to Set Value 3 (P-3) set mode. • Check Set Value 3 (P-3) which has been set automatically. When Set Value 3 (P-3) is to be changed, enter Set Value 3 (P-3) using key and key. • After checking and setting, press key to set to sensing mode.
